Moraxella atlantae
**Semantic type:** Bacterium
**Definition:** A species of aerobic, Gram negative, rod shaped bacteria assigned to the phylum Proteobacteria. This species is oxidase positive, negative for urease, phenylalanine deaminase and tryptophan deaminase, is unable to grow on solid medium at 4 to 10 degrees C, and is relatively halointolerant. M. atlantae is normally found in human blood and is an emerging nosocomial pathogen.
**Synonyms:** - CDC Group M-3 - MORAXELLA ATLANTAE
